  • The Wonder of Words: Coaching as Sacred Space with Dr. Haesun Moon
    Dec 10 2025

    Send us a text

    In this unforgettable episode of the ICF San Diego's Coffee and Conversations podcast. Our host, Donald E. Coleman, shares a sacred moment with Dr. Haesun Moon, author of Coaching A to Z and a renowned thought leader in the science of coaching language.

    From the moment Donald attended her ICF Converge 2025 breakout session, The Wonder of Words: Curating Preferred Futures One Word at a Time, he knew something extraordinary was unfolding. In a conference brimming with an abundance of tools and academic coaching dialogue, Dr. Moon offered something different: light, presence, and deep simplicity that stirred the soul.

    This long-awaited interview captures that same sacred stillness. Together, Donald and Haesun explore:

    • The power of words to shift perspective, create space, and unlock new futures
    • How metaphors like “zero” and “instead” carry transformational impact in coaching conversations
    • The Compass Diagram, a quadrant model that maps language to embodied experience
    • The role of grief, prayer, and intuitive writing in her creative process
    • How mind, heart, and gut intelligence converge through coaching presence
    • The quiet healing found in honoring “what is already,” “what is becoming,” and “what is cared for”

    Dr. Moon’s reflections are not merely conceptual—they are deeply spiritual, embodied, and generational. Her insights carry the kind of weight that has the power to shape coaches, clients, and families for years to come.

  • A Sacred Conversation with Alla Shashkina, ACC
    Nov 13 2025

    In this sacred and soul-stirring episode of Coffee and Conversations, host Donald E. Coleman welcomes Alla Shashkina, ACC, for a conversation that transcends professional titles and enters the realm of calling, healing, and generational transformation.

    Donald and Alla reflect on her experience that occurred at ICF San Diego's hospitality suite on Thursday night during the 2025 ICF Converge, where Donald delivered an impromptu moving speech on how coaching was recognized not merely as a profession, but as a divine calling. Alla shares her powerful personal story—from her roots as a Chuvash woman in Russia, to raising her daughter as a single mother, to reclaiming connection through movement, mindfulness, and presence. Their conversation uncovers how sacred moments arise in coaching, and how flexibility, awareness, and embodied intelligence allow coaches to serve not just individuals, but the healing of generations.

    Together, they explore:

    • The role of sacred space in coaching and life
    • How movement, running, and silence become portals for presence
    • Generational healing and the coach’s role in shaping non-material legacy
    • Embodied metaphors for resilience and flexibility in a fast-paced world
    • Integrating mind, heart, and gut intelligence into leadership and life
    • How disconnection from one’s calling leads to fragmentation—and how coaching restores wholeness

  • A Conversation with Dr. Akihiko Morita, PCC
    Oct 24 2025

    Live from San Diego | Coffee and Conversations Podcast with Donald E. Coleman

    In this powerful special edition of Coffee and Conversations, recorded live at the ICF Global Converge 2025 Conference in San Diego, host Donald E. Coleman sits down with Dr. Akihiko Morita, board director at the ICF Thought Leadership Institute and presenter of the session Beyond the Human Coach: AI, Wisdom Traditions, and the Future of Coaching.

    Together, they explore how AI is reshaping the coaching profession—not as a replacement for the human coach, but as a partner in transformation. Dr. Morita shares deep insights on relational epistemology, spiritual intelligence, and the emerging dynamic of AI–human dialogue. Drawing on both neuroscience and ancient wisdom traditions, this conversation redefines what it means to coach—and to be human—in an AI-augmented world.
